A novel reconstruction framework for an imaging calorimeter for HL-LHC
<!--HTML-->To sustain the harsher conditions of the high-luminosity LHC, the CMS collaboration is designing a novel endcap calorimeter system. The new calorimeter will predominantly use silicon sensors to achieve sufficient radiation tolerance and will maintain highly-granular information in t...
